2021 Los Angeles Angels: Spring Training Update, Ohtani Rolls

The 2021 Los Angeles Angels have had a positive Cactus League season so far and with one week to the regular season, Shohei Ohtani has once again been a standout.

Sunday it was true double duty for Ohtani who started on the mound and hit leadoff for the Angels in their Cactus League game against the Padres. He hadn’t done that in the MLB since first arriving in 2018. 

2021 Los Angeles Angels: Ohtani Continues to Roll

Fernando Tatis Jr. can bat flip all he wants in spring training but he can’t hit and pitch in the same game. 

Ohtani had two hits, a walk, and five strikeouts in four innings on the mound. He broke the 100 mph hour barrier and gave up one run in Sunday"s game against the San Diego Padres.

Ohtani has been hampered by a Tommy John surgery that has plagued him since first being diagnosed with elbow pain way back in 2018. 

Ohtani actually faced Tatis Jr. and showed him what a 102 mile an hour pitch looks like. Ohtani has two hits in 20 at-bats before Sunday, with four homers.

Jo Adell Optioned and Other Moves

Jo Adell will go to the 2021 Los Angeles Angels alternate site before heading to Triple-A Salt Lake this season. Adell is one of the Angels" top prospects who broke in during the shortened 2020 season. 

Kyle Keller, Matt Thaiss and Jose Suarez were also optioned by the club.  

Adell slashed .161/.212/.266 with three home runs and seven RBI with 55 strikeouts in 38 games. The 21-year-old also struggled defensively in the outfield and with the 2021 Los Angels Angels adding Dexter Fowler among others, they don’t have to rush Adell. 

Juan Lagares, Taylor Ward, and Scott Schebler have all had batting averages above .350 this spring. Justin Upton will also slot in the outfield and has performed admirably in Arizona. Brandon Marsh and Jordyn Adams are also gunning for outfield spots.

JJoe Maddon Clarifies Roles of Some Players

2021 Los Angeles Angels Manager Joe Maddon also clarified potential roles for Reid Detmers and Chris Rodriguez, two top Angels pitching prospects.

Rodriguez could see time both as a starter and reliever with Detmers seeing some time on the mound as a starter. Detmers was drafted 10th overall by the Angels in June 2020 and showed some flashes in outings against the White Sox why the Angels think so highly of him.
